1 /*
2 * SPDX-License-Identifier: LGPL-2.1-only
3 *
4 * Copyright (C) 2008-2012 Mathieu Desnoyers <mathieu.desnoyers@efficios.com>
5 *
6 * Ring buffer backend (types).
7 */
8
9 #ifndef _LTTNG_RING_BUFFER_BACKEND_TYPES_H
10 #define _LTTNG_RING_BUFFER_BACKEND_TYPES_H
11
12 #include <limits.h>
13 #include <stdint.h>
14 #include "shm_internal.h"
15 #include "vatomic.h"
16
17 #define RB_BACKEND_PAGES_PADDING 16
18 struct lttng_ust_lib_ring_buffer_backend_pages {
19 unsigned long mmap_offset; /* offset of the subbuffer in mmap */
20 union v_atomic records_commit; /* current records committed count */
21 union v_atomic records_unread; /* records to read */
22 unsigned long data_size; /* Amount of data to read from subbuf */
23 DECLARE_SHMP(char, p); /* Backing memory map */
24 char padding[RB_BACKEND_PAGES_PADDING];
25 };
26
27 struct lttng_ust_lib_ring_buffer_backend_subbuffer {
28 /* Identifier for subbuf backend pages. Exchanged atomically. */
29 unsigned long id; /* backend subbuffer identifier */
30 };
31
32 struct lttng_ust_lib_ring_buffer_backend_counts {
33 /*
34 * Counter specific to the sub-buffer location within the ring buffer.
35 * The actual sequence number of the packet within the entire ring
36 * buffer can be derived from the formula nr_subbuffers * seq_cnt +
37 * subbuf_idx.
38 */
39 uint64_t seq_cnt; /* packet sequence number */
40 };
41
42 /*
43 * Forward declaration of frontend-specific channel and ring_buffer.
44 */
45 struct channel;
46 struct lttng_ust_lib_ring_buffer;
47
48 struct lttng_ust_lib_ring_buffer_backend_pages_shmp {
49 DECLARE_SHMP(struct lttng_ust_lib_ring_buffer_backend_pages, shmp);
50 };
51
52 #define RB_BACKEND_RING_BUFFER_PADDING 64
53 struct lttng_ust_lib_ring_buffer_backend {
54 /* Array of ring_buffer_backend_subbuffer for writer */
55 DECLARE_SHMP(struct lttng_ust_lib_ring_buffer_backend_subbuffer, buf_wsb);
56 /* ring_buffer_backend_subbuffer for reader */
57 struct lttng_ust_lib_ring_buffer_backend_subbuffer buf_rsb;
58 /* Array of lib_ring_buffer_backend_counts for the packet counter */
59 DECLARE_SHMP(struct lttng_ust_lib_ring_buffer_backend_counts, buf_cnt);
60 /*
61 * Pointer array of backend pages, for whole buffer.
62 * Indexed by ring_buffer_backend_subbuffer identifier (id) index.
63 */
64 DECLARE_SHMP(struct lttng_ust_lib_ring_buffer_backend_pages_shmp, array);
65 DECLARE_SHMP(char, memory_map); /* memory mapping */
66
67 DECLARE_SHMP(struct channel, chan); /* Associated channel */
68 int cpu; /* This buffer's cpu. -1 if global. */
69 union v_atomic records_read; /* Number of records read */
70 unsigned int allocated:1; /* is buffer allocated ? */
71 char padding[RB_BACKEND_RING_BUFFER_PADDING];
72 };
73
74 struct lttng_ust_lib_ring_buffer_shmp {
75 DECLARE_SHMP(struct lttng_ust_lib_ring_buffer, shmp); /* Channel per-cpu buffers */
76 };
77
78 #define RB_BACKEND_CHANNEL_PADDING 64
79 struct channel_backend {
80 unsigned long buf_size; /* Size of the buffer */
81 unsigned long subbuf_size; /* Sub-buffer size */
82 unsigned int subbuf_size_order; /* Order of sub-buffer size */
83 unsigned int num_subbuf_order; /*
84 * Order of number of sub-buffers/buffer
85 * for writer.
86 */
87 unsigned int buf_size_order; /* Order of buffer size */
88 unsigned int extra_reader_sb:1; /* has extra reader subbuffer ? */
89 unsigned long num_subbuf; /* Number of sub-buffers for writer */
90 uint64_t start_tsc; /* Channel creation TSC value */
91 DECLARE_SHMP(void *, priv_data);/* Client-specific information */
92 struct lttng_ust_lib_ring_buffer_config config; /* Ring buffer configuration */
93 char name[NAME_MAX]; /* Channel name */
94 char padding[RB_BACKEND_CHANNEL_PADDING];
95 struct lttng_ust_lib_ring_buffer_shmp buf[];
96 };
97
98 #endif /* _LTTNG_RING_BUFFER_BACKEND_TYPES_H */
